Advancements in Air Filter Technology: Breath of Fresh Air for a Healthier Tomorrow
Air pollution is a growing concern worldwide, with the World Health Organization (WHO) estimating that air pollution is responsible for 7 million premature deaths annually. In response, air filter technology has evolved significantly, offering innovative solutions to tackle the growing issue of indoor and outdoor air pollution. This article explores the latest advancements in air filter technology, highlighting the new and emerging trends that are set to shape the future of clean air.
Smart Air Filters: The Next Generation of Filtration
Smart air filters, equipped with advanced sensors and IoT connectivity, are revolutionizing the way we monitor and maintain indoor air quality. These intelligent filters can detect and respond to changes in pollution levels, automatically adjusting their performance to optimize air cleaning efficiency. This technology has far-reaching implications, particularly in enclosed spaces like hospitals, offices, and homes, where a single contaminated air particle can have devastating consequences.
UV-C Light Technology: A New Frontier in Air Purification
UV-C light technology is another key area of innovation in air filter technology. By emitting ultraviolet light at a specific wavelength, these systems can destroy up to 99.9% of microorganisms, viruses, and bacteria, rendering them ineffective as pollutants. This technology is being integrated into various applications, including HVAC systems, air purifiers, and even mobile devices, to create a healthier indoor environment.
Nano-Coated Filters: The Future of High-Efficiency Filtration
Nano-coated filters are made up of ultra-thin, precisely engineered fibers that can capture even the smallest particles, down to 0.1 microns. This results in a significantly higher level of efficiency, making them ideal for applications in high-risk environments, such as hospitals, laboratories, and aerospace industries.
Application Areas: Where Air Filter Technology is Having a Significant Impact
Air filter technology is transforming various industries, including:
- Healthcare: With the emergence of smart air filters and UV-C light technology, hospitals and healthcare facilities can now maintain optimal indoor air quality, reducing the risk of Hospital-Acquired Infections (HAIs) and improving patient outcomes.
- Commercial Properties: Innovative air filter solutions are being integrated into office buildings and shopping centers, ensuring a healthier work environment and a more pleasant customer experience.
- Aerospace: Air filter technology is crucial in the aerospace industry, where cabin air quality is critical for both crew and passenger comfort and health.
- Automotive: Smart air filters are being developed for vehicles, enhancing ventilation systems and reducing the risk of interior air pollution.
- Residential: With the rise of smart homes, air filter technology is being integrated into HVAC systems, enabling homeowners to monitor and maintain optimal indoor air quality.
